Choosing the Right Animal Hospital

The process of choosing an animal hospital in Cedar Rapids is very similar to the process of choosing a health care physician for any family member. The strongest factor that should influence a decision is from reviews and referrals from existing or past customers of the veterinary clinic. Most pet owners are very attached to their furry loved ones, so they are very opinionated about their experiences with the veterinary clinic, whether positive or negative.

Another thing to keep in mind when trying to choose a veterinary clinic is whether or not they offer a full line of services. Does the veterinary clinic have machines and facilities to make diagnostic tests and treatments there? Is the clinic also able to perform any necessary surgeries? Is the veterinary clinic available for any after hour emergencies? These are just a few of the services to check when choosing a veterinary clinic.

General Pet Care

In addition to the services offered, it is also wise to check the fees associated with some of the main services like regular checkups and exams, emergency and after hour fees if the veterinary clinic offers this service, vaccinations, etc. These costs can vary greatly from one veterinary clinic to another, so it is always wise to check out all of the fees beforehand.

A third step in deciding whether to go with a certain animal hospital in Cedar Rapids, IA or not is to speak with the vet and staff directly. Always pay careful attention to the interaction between the vet and staff with a pet. This may seem like a simple thing to mention, but it is absolutely the best way to tell if the vet and staff truly care about the animals or not. Some are just in it for the business while others are in it for the love of animals. This is very important because if they truly love animals then they will truly take great care of the animals brought to them.
